Cancer miracles
By Robert Langreth, Forbes.com

Charles Burrows noticed a strange lump on his stomach in the summer of 2005. By November the pain was so bad it felt like a knife was stabbing him in the stomach. A ct scan and a biopsy confirmed Burrows' worst fears: He had inoperable liver cancer.

Few cancers have a worse prognosis. His tumor, the size of a baseball, was already starting to strangle the portal vein going into the liver. Doctors at the Phoenix Veterans Affairs Health Care System told Burrows, then 56 years old, there was nothing they could do. "They said, 'Get your affairs in order because you have 30 days to live, maybe 60,'" recalls Burrows, who is divorced with three grown kids.

Burrows quit his carpentry job and spent the next two months in a fog. Then things got very strange. In February 2006 Burrows developed abdominal bloating, shaking, chills and nausea. Soon after that he noticed that the lump on his stomach was gone. By then his daughter had found a doctor in private practice willing to consider treating him. But the doctor couldn't find a tumor. He went back to the VA, where gastroenterologist Nooman Gilani was flabbergasted when computed tomography and magnetic resonance imaging scans showed no sign of cancer. Where the tumor had once been, there was "literally empty space," Gilani says.
Burrows remains free of cancer three years later and still seems dazed by the turn of events. "I won a lottery, and I don't understand why," he says. "I would like someone to explain to me what the heck happened."
